LB 134 5. Contamination Measurements
40
Figure 4.6: Background menu for contamination probe
Set the desired parameters for the background measure-
ment.
Background: Shows the currently stored -
background. It may come from a back-
ground measurement or it can be entered
manually. The stored background is al-
ways subtracted from each measure-
ment.

Meas. Time: Enter the desired measuring time. Enter
at least 60 seconds, better 600 seconds
in order to get accurate results.
Autostart: When ON is set (X mark), a background
measurement is carried out automatically
whenever the device is turned on.
BG Meas. Time: If a background measurement was car-
ried out, the elapsed background meas-
urement time is entered here after sav-
ing. On the other hand, if you have en-
tered the background by hand, you have
to enter the measuring time associated
with the background, so that the accura-
cy calculation is correct for a contamina-
tion measurement.
Start the background measurement by moving the cursor
() to Measure background and press the Enter key.
Then the background measurement starts.
